  • Another day, another Chinese copy…

    This one is from DongFen.Which usually builds cars for Nissan. This one uses the design of the previous Kia Sorento with a Cadillac SRX front end. Go figure… The engine is a 2.0 Liter from Nissan. The whole thing is supposedly priced at around $12 000.
